Dispatches from O'Reilly: The right amount of spec for agentic development

The article discusses the trade-offs in specifying requirements for agentic AI development, arguing that neither zero specification nor full formal specs are ideal. It suggests a balanced approach with enough structure and executable checks to reduce costly trial-and-error and clarify intent.
